A Rising Profile for a Cult Filmmaker

Lucile Hadzihalilovic, a french filmmaker ⁤of ⁢Bosnian descent, has cultivated a uniquely refined style over two decades. While ⁢previously known primarily within festival circuits,her work is gaining wider recognition,with her fourth feature film,Ice ⁤Tower,receiving direct imports at Cinémas du Grütli in Geneva and Cinématographe in ⁣Lausanne as of October 29,2025.Despite modest initial admissions for her debut, Innocence (2004, featuring Marion Cotillard), Hadzihalilovic’s ⁣distinct vision is finding a growing audience.

*Ice Tower*: A Modern Fairy Tale

Ice Tower is a striking adaptation of ‍Hans Christian Andersen’s classic tale, The Snow Queen. The film doesn’t offer a straightforward retelling, but rather a diffraction‍ – a bending and breaking of the original ‍story into something new and unsettling. It’s a visually arresting and emotionally resonant‍ work that marks a important moment in Hadzihalilovic’s career.

Exploring themes of Isolation and Transformation

Hadzihalilovic’s films are known for their exploration of themes like isolation, transformation, ⁣and the unsettling nature of the human body. ‍ Ice Tower continues this trend, presenting a world that is both gorgeous and deeply disturbing. The film’s visual style is characterized by it’s meticulous composition, evocative use of color, and a deliberate pacing that allows the atmosphere to build. Critics have noted the film’s dreamlike quality and its ability ⁤to⁢ linger in the mind long after viewing.

The ⁢film’s approach to the source material is less about narrative fidelity and more about ⁢capturing the emotional core of Andersen’s story. The icy landscape and the characters’ internal struggles ⁢serve as metaphors for the challenges of growing up and the pain of loss.
